We are looking for a Patient Access Specialist to support front-end patient services in a busy healthcare setting in Roanoke, Virginia. This contract to permanent oppportunity is ideal for someone who enjoys helping patients, maintaining accurate information, and keeping daily administrative workflows organized. The person in this role will serve as a key point of contact for patients and visitors while helping ensure each interaction is handled efficiently and professionally.


Responsibilities:

• Greet patients and visitors in a courteous manner and create a welcoming experience from arrival through check-in.

• Complete patient intake tasks by entering demographic details, confirming coverage information, and maintaining accurate records.

• Coordinate appointment scheduling, send confirmations, and assist with follow-up changes to support clinic operations.

• Receive payments such as co-pays and reconcile daily collections with accuracy and attention to detail.

• Partner with medical and administrative staff to keep patient movement and office activity running smoothly throughout the day.

• Respond to patient questions and concerns with professionalism, and route more complex issues to the appropriate team members when needed.

• Safeguard sensitive health information by following privacy standards and established confidentiality procedures.

• Experience with customer service, patient services, or other people facing roles required.

• Ability to assist patients professionally while providing clear and courteous service.

• Working knowledge of appointment scheduling and front-desk coordination.

• Familiarity with patient registrar responsibilities, including intake and record updates.

• Experience verifying medical insurance information accurately.

• Strong communication, organization, and multitasking skills in a fast-paced setting.

• Comfortable handling payment collection and maintaining accuracy in administrative tasks.
